Understanding the Ingredients
To make the perfect Cheesy Beefy Delight Stuffed Shells, it’s crucial to understand the key ingredients that contribute to the dish’s incredible flavor and nutritional value. Here’s a closer look at what you’ll need:
Jumbo Pasta Shells
The star of the dish, jumbo pasta shells, are large, hollow pasta pieces specifically designed to be stuffed. Their unique shape allows them to hold generous amounts of filling, making each bite a delightful surprise. When selecting pasta, look for high-quality brands that use durum wheat, as they provide a firmer texture and better flavor.
Ground Beef
Ground beef is the primary protein in this dish, providing richness and a satisfying bite. Opt for ground beef with a moderate fat content (around 80/20) for the perfect balance of flavor and juiciness. Leaner options may lead to a dry filling, while fattier cuts can introduce excessive grease. Cooking the beef properly is key; browning it enhances the flavor through the Maillard reaction, creating a deliciously savory base for your filling.
Ricotta Cheese
Ricotta cheese adds creaminess and a light texture to the filling. Its mild flavor allows it to blend seamlessly with the other ingredients. When choosing ricotta, look for whole-milk varieties for the best taste and creaminess. This cheese also provides protein and calcium, making the dish more nutritious.
Cheese Blend
In addition to ricotta, a blend of shredded mozzarella and Parmesan cheese elevates the dish to another level. Mozzarella provides that iconic stretchy, gooey quality, while Parmesan adds a sharp, nutty flavor that enhances the overall taste. Combining these cheeses creates a harmonious blend of flavors and textures.
Herbs and Aromatics
Fresh herbs like parsley or basil, along with aromatics such as onions and garlic, are essential for adding depth to the filling. Herbs not only enhance the flavor but also contribute to the nutritional profile of the dish, offering vitamins and antioxidants. Sautéing onions and garlic until they are fragrant and slightly caramelized brings out their natural sweetness, creating a flavor base that complements the beef and cheeses perfectly.
Marinara Sauce
A good marinara sauce is the finishing touch that brings everything together. You can use store-bought varieties for convenience, but making homemade sauce allows you to control the flavors and ingredients. A well-seasoned marinara adds acidity and brightness, cutting through the richness of the cheese and beef.

Step-by-Step Guide to Making Cheesy Beefy Delight Stuffed Shells
Preparing the Pasta
1. Cook the Jumbo Pasta Shells: Start by bringing a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il. Carefully add the jumbo pasta shells and cook them according to the package instructions, typically around 9-11 minutes. For stuffed shells, it’s essential to achieve an al dente texture—cooked but still firm to the bite. This will help prevent the shells from becoming mushy during the baking process.
2. Check for Doneness: Periodically check the pasta for doneness by tasting a shell. You want it to be tender yet firm enough to hold its shape when filled.
3. Rinse with Cold Water: Once the shells are cooked to perfection, drain them in a colander. To stop the cooking process and prevent them from sticking together, rinse the shells under cold running water. This step is crucial as it allows you to handle the shells more easily when filling them.
4. Set Aside: Spread the shells out on a clean kitchen towel or parchment paper to cool slightly while you prepare the filling. This will make it easier to fill them without burning your fingers.
Creating the Flavorful Filling
1. Brown the Ground Beef: In a large skillet over medium heat, add a drizzle of olive oil and allow it to heat up. Once hot, add the ground beef, breaking it apart with a spatula. Cook for about 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it is browned and cooked through.
2. Drain Excess Fat: After the beef is browned, it’s essential to drain any excess fat. You want the beef to be flavorful, but too much grease can make the filling heavy and unappetizing. Use a colander or carefully tilt the skillet to remove the fat, keeping the beef in the pan.
3. Sauté Aromatics: Once the beef is drained, push it to one side of the skillet and add diced onions and minced garlic to the other side. Sauté these aromatics for about 2-3 minutes until they are soft and fragrant. This step adds depth and complexity to the filling.
4. Combine Ingredients for the Filling: In a large mixing bowl, combine the sautéed beef, onions, and garlic with ricotta cheese, shredded mozzarella, grated Parmesan, and chopped fresh herbs. Season the mixture with salt, pepper, and a pinch of Italian seasoning to taste. Use a spatula or wooden spoon to mix everything until well combined. The filling should be creamy and packed with flavor, ready to be stuffed into the pasta shells.

Stuffing the Shells
Stuffing pasta shells might seem daunting, but with a few techniques, you can easily fill them without breaking or tearing. Here are some effective methods to ensure your stuffed shells are perfectly filled and ready for baking:
1. Use a Disposable Piping Bag: One of the easiest ways to stuff shells is to use a disposable piping bag or a resealable plastic bag with the corner cut off. This method allows for precise filling without making a mess. Simply spoon your cheese and beef mixture into the bag, seal it, and squeeze the mixture into each shell.
2. Employ a Small Spoon or Offset Spatula: If you prefer a more hands-on approach, a small spoon or an offset spatula can also work well. Gently open each shell and use the spoon or spatula to push the filling into the shell. Ensure you fill them generously, but don’t overstuff, as this may cause them to burst during baking.
3. Work on a Stable Surface: Place the shells on a clean, flat surface while filling them. This stability helps prevent them from rolling around and makes it easier to stuff them without the risk of breaking.
4. Fill in a Systematic Order: To keep track of your progress and to avoid any shells being left empty, consider filling them in a systematic order. For example, fill the shells from left to right or in rows, which will make the process more organized.
Assembling the Dish
Once your shells are stuffed, it’s time to assemble them in the baking dish. This step is crucial for ensuring that your Cheesy Beefy Delight Stuffed Shells are flavorful and moist.
1. Prepare the Baking Dish: Start by spreading a thin layer of marinara sauce on the bottom of your baking dish. This not only prevents the shells from sticking but also infuses them with flavor as they bake. Use about a cup of marinara sauce, enough to create a nice base layer.
2. Arrange the Stuffed Shells: Carefully place the stuffed shells in the dish, open side up. Arrange them in a single layer, ensuring they are not overcrowded. This allows for even cooking and prevents them from sticking together. If your dish is large enough, you can fit two layers, but make sure to adjust the sauce accordingly.
3. Add Sauce and Cheese: Generously cover the stuffed shells with additional marinara sauce, ensuring each shell is well-coated. This coverage is vital for keeping the shells moist during baking. After the sauce, sprinkle a generous layer of shredded mozzarella cheese over the top. This will melt beautifully, creating a bubbly, golden crust that is simply irresistible. For an extra touch, consider adding grated Parmesan cheese on top for added flavor.
Baking the Cheesy Beefy Delight
Now that your dish is fully assembled, it’s time to bake it to perfection.
1. Set the Oven Temperature: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). This temperature is ideal for cooking the shells thoroughly while allowing the cheese to melt without burning.
2. Cover with Foil: To retain moisture during the initial phase of baking, cover the baking dish with aluminum foil. This step is crucial as it helps steam the shells, ensuring they are tender and flavorful. Bake covered for about 25 minutes.
3. Uncover and Continue Baking: After 25 minutes, carefully remove the foil and continue baking for an additional 10-15 minutes. This step allows the cheese to bubble and become golden brown. You know your dish is done when the cheese is melted, bubbly, and slightly browned, and the sauce is simmering.
Garnishing and Serving Suggestions
The final touches can elevate your Cheesy Beefy Delight Stuffed Shells from delicious to exquisite.
1. Final Touches: Once out of the oven, sprinkle freshly chopped parsley over the top for a burst of color and freshness. This not only enhances the presentation but also adds a vibrant flavor that complements the rich, cheesy filling.
2. Pairing Side Dishes: To create a well-rounded meal, consider serving your stuffed shells with a simple side salad dressed with balsamic vinaigrette or steamed vegetables such as broccoli or green beans. Garlic bread is another fantastic accompaniment, perfect for soaking up any extra marinara sauce.
3. Serving Tips: When serving, consider using a large serving spoon or spatula to portion out the shells. Ensure each serving includes some of the marinara sauce and melted cheese for the best experience.
